Transaction e2d389f24496f1645e48c99620e4a0076c45452b688315624d600b5b9f1b9f21

4 Input
1 Outputs
  • e2d389f24496f1645e48c99620e4a0076c45452b688315624d600b5b9f1b9f21:0
  • value  1180612
    address  3JDasg1WBUVfg2ntdq4VhR7zh5qBnLJXYm